What is Esports?

Esports refers to competitive video gaming, where individuals or teams compete in organized tournaments. This phenomenon has gained substantial traction, attracting millions of viewers and substantial financial investments. The growth of esports is evident in its increasing sponsorship deals and prize pools. It’s fascinating to see how traditional sports are being mirrored in this digital arena.     Event Formats and Structures

    Event formats in esports vary significantly, impacting competition dynamics. He should consider how single-elimination structures create high stakes. This format intensifies pressure on players. Every match counts.

    Additionally, round-robin formats promote consistent performance evaluation. He must recognize the importance of multiple matchups. This structure allows for comprehensive skill assessment. It’s a fair approach.

    Furthermore, team-based tournaments often feature diverse formats. He needs to understand how this affects strategy. Different structures can influence team dynamics.
